    Abstract: An inductive cooktop system includes a top plate that has a top surface for supporting a cookware object. A display is disposed below the top plate, and induction coils are arranged in a matrix and disposed vertically below the display. The induction coils are each operable to generate a magnetic field that partially extends above the top surface of the top plate to couple with the cookware object. A control system receives an initial input indicating a position of the cookware object on the top surface of the top plate. Data processing hardware of the control system then determines the pixels of the display corresponding to the indicated position from the input. The control system then generates a graphic at the indicated position for the cookware object by illuminating the plurality of pixels of the display.

    Abstract: An appliance has an insulated compartment with a door that is movable between a closed position and an open position for accessing an interior cavity of the insulated compartment. A window panel is disposed at the door for viewing the interior cavity when the door in in the closed position. A display overlays at least a portion of the window panel, so as to display information that is visible at an exterior surface of the door. The display is also at least partially transparent for viewing the interior cavity through the window panel and the display. A transparent thermal insulator is disposed between the window panel and the display to prevent the interior cavity from heating or cooling the display outside of an operating temperature range.

    Abstract: A molecular single electron transistor (MSET) detector device (14) is described that comprises at least one organic molecule (87) connecting a drain electrode (84) and a source electrode (82). In use, said at least one organic molecule (87) provides a quantum confinement region. At least one analyte receptor site (90, 92) is provided in the vicinity of said at least one organic molecule (87) that bind molecules of interest (analytes). A fluid analyser (2) is also described that includes the MSET detector, a pre-concentrator (4) and a fluid gating structure (6). The fluid gating structure (6) is arranged to selectively route fluid from the pre-concentrator (4) to either one of the detector (14) and an exhaust port (12). The pre-concentrator (4), fluid gating structure (6) and detector (14) are each formed as substantially planar layers and arranged in a stack or cube.

    Abstract: A bistable display device comprises two cell walls enclosing a sheet having a plurality of cavities each containing a rotatable bicoloured sphere within a liquid crystal material carrier (15), and electrodes for applying an electrical field. The spheres and cavities are provided with a surface alignment which imposes a substantially unidirectional director alignment on the liquid crystal material in contact with them. The elastic distortion free energy of the liquid crystal material in each cavity is arranged to be zero when the preferred direction of the suspended spheres coincides with that of the surrounding cavity, e.g. black upwards. It is also zero when the sphere is rotated through 180° to present its opposite hemisphere which has a contrasting optical appearance, e.g. black downwards. Between these two states, there is an energetic barrier determined by the elastic constants of the liquid crystal which provides both a threshold for switching and improved bistability.
